29 1. Give a Scripture that allows us to know we should tarry for the promise of the Holy Spirit? Luke 24:49.

30 2. When can we truly say we are Pentecostal? We can truly say that we are Pentecostal when we possess Pentecost.

31 3. Is being Pentecostal a denomination or an experience? Being Pentecostal is an experience. We receive salvation and become born again through the baptism of the Holy Spirit. This experience imparts to us the power of God and enables us to be witnesses (Acts 1:8).

32 4. Is it necessary to have the baptism of the Holy Spirit? Yes, it is necessary to have the baptism of the Holy Spirit. If it was necessary for the Apostles, Mary the Mother of Jesus, and other disciples of Jesus Christ to have the Spirit then it is necessary for us to have it also. These disciples had walked with Jesus for three and one half years. They had witnessed, preached, and even cast out devils. They could do these great works because Jesus was there with them. However, when He ascended, another Comforter had to be sent (John 14:16). This Comforter was just the same as having Jesus walking with them again....Christ in you, the hope of glory. (Colossians 1:27) He comes into us through the baptism of the Holy Spirit.

33 5. What can we learn from the woman who wouldnt quit and the friend at midnight stories taken from the Word of God? From the two stories, the Woman Who Wouldnt Quit, and the Friend at Midnight, we learn the following: ASK...it shall be given you. SEEK...and ye shall find. KNOCK...it shall be opened to you. He that ASKS...RECEIVES; SEEKS...FINDS; KNOCKS...DOOR OPENED. (Luke 11:9-10)

34 6. Provide a Scripture that proves God will do whatever He promises? Scriptures that proves that God will do whatever He promises are Romans 4:21 and Numbers 23:19. (Note: The student only needs one of these references.)
